Cannot start, no visible error, it just don't seems to open
I bought the pack, and none of the 2 Syberia runs. Im currentily using Windows 8, with a Intel/Nvidia Geforce GT 750m.

I tried to open the game via the game.exe nothing happens, i tried 8 bit, and compatibility mode no luck either. Any help?

Ok I tried again and i get it to work, this is how I did it:

Put game.exe and syberia.exe on:
- Compatibility Mode (Windows XP SP3)
- Reduced Color 8 Bit mode (256 colours)
- Run as Administrator (This made the difference this time)

It ran,( but it took some seconds) and brought up a warning saying that "DirectPlay" was needed to run the game. And it offered me to install it. I installed it and it worked.

I think that maybe the problem is with the configuration that Steam does with the DirectX part, because when I ran the exe's without the "As administrator" box checked it didn't offer me to install that DirectX needed part.

I don't know if it will be of any help, but... do you have any firewall / protection software running? I had a similarly looking problem (black screen, no pc response, compatibility settings/color limit did not help) and managed to solve it by disabling Comodo Personal Firewall/Defense+ (closed app altogether, just enabling "game mode" didn't make it). It seems to me that after switching to fullscreen, protection software attempts do display block/allow popup underneath and hangs everything. Also I enabled XP SP3 compatibility on main game file, as well as all other options including run as administrator and disable desktop themes (it seems that resolution limit can be left unchecked for game to start normally). You may hear audio but see nothing, but it should start (it did for me ;) ) - you can then use Ctr+Alt+Del/Esc/Alt+Tab to switch back and forth and menu should appear. Alternatively you may use the player.ini file fix to start it in windowed mode. Win7 64/AMD GPU here. This may or may not work for other protection apps. Hope this can help somebody...

On a Win 7, 64bit, NVIDIA GeForce GTX 680M. Had the same issues when starting the game: Would go to black and stability issues. All issues were resolved when I changed my resolution to 800x600.

This game was originally released in 2002. Resolutions were different then. ;)

Hey guys, I was having a similar issue and I hope this helps some of you.

I'm currently running a MSi GT70 DominatorPro 2PE with a GeForce GTX880M and Windows 8.1. I went to the local files and adjusted the properties of the Syberia.exe and Game.exe files to the Windows XP SP3 setting and it ran with no issues. I did not adjust the color settings at all.
